Transaction 59173a21eceeb12a7c4e3b4ba0f6c022bf85ebaa71858d0f8ed06ffe1a50e07d

1 Input
1 Outputs
  • 59173a21eceeb12a7c4e3b4ba0f6c022bf85ebaa71858d0f8ed06ffe1a50e07d:0
  • value  20000000
    address  3H2a18UYkvZozJTyW4xunhbw727mEjeQ5v